It was time for Papa Bear to read Brother,


Sister, and Honey a bedtime story. But the cubs
couldnt agree on a story. Brother wanted an
exciting story about Space Grizzlies. Sister wanted
a nice story about princesses. Honey wanted a
happy story about bunnies or chipmunks.

Lets read a Bible story, said Papa. The


Bible has all kinds of storiesexciting ones,
nice ones, happy ones, even serious ones.
The cubs liked Bible stories. They were
all about sword fights and floods and wild
animalsall sorts of interesting things.

Okay, Brother and


Sister agreed. And even
Honey clapped.

0310727219_bb_storybook_bible_int.indd 6

12/12/12 1:48 PM

So Papa got out the storybook Bible and began to read.


The cubs had fun imagining that all the characters in the
stories were bears, just like them!

The New Testament


The Birth of Jesus: Luke 1
A young woman named Mary lived in the city of
Nazareth. An angel came from God to give Mary
wonderful news.
The angel greeted her and said, You are blessed
by the Lord!

Mary was afraid. But the angel comforted her, saying,


Fear not, for you are special to God. You will have a baby
boy who you will name Jesus. He will be called the Son of
the Highest.
Mary said, How can that be since I am not yet married?
With God nothing is impossible, the angel told her.
And Mary said, I am the servant of the Lord.

At that time, everyone in the Holy Land had to be


counted and put on a list. Mary was going to marry
Joseph whose family came from Bethlehem. So they
had to travel to Bethlehem to be counted, even though
Mary was close to having her baby.

When Mary and Joseph got to Bethlehem,


it was very crowded. The only place they
could find to stay was the stable at an inn. It
was warm and dry and that is where Mary
had her baby. She wrapped him in cloths and
laid him in the manger where the animals ate.

Nearby, shepherds were watching over their flocks.


An angel came to them in a bright light, and they were
afraid.
Dont be afraid, said the angel. I bring good news
for everyone. Today, Christ the Lord is born. You will
find the baby lying in a manger.
Suddenly, other angels joined him saying,
Glory to God! Peace on earth!

183

0310727219_bb_storybook_bible_int.indd 183

12/12/12 2:00 PM

The shepherds hurried to Bethlehem and


saw Mary, Joseph, with the baby Jesus lying
in a manger. Then they told everyone they
met what they had seen.

The Three Wise Men: Matthew 2


After Jesus was born, three wise men came from the
east to the holy city of Jerusalem.
They asked, Where is the child who is born a king?
We have seen his star and followed it to worship him.

King Herod, who ruled the land, heard about


this. He was worried. Who was this child who
people called a king? He told the wise men to find
the child and tell him where he was.

189

0310727219_bb_storybook_bible_int.indd 189

12/12/12 2:00 PM

The wise men followed the star that


went before them. It led them to the
house where Mary, Joseph, and Jesus
were staying.

The wise men bowed down


and worshipped Jesus. They
gave him gold and other
precious gifts.
God told them in a dream not
to go back to King Herod. So
they left and traveled back home
another way.

An angel came to Joseph in a dream and told


him King Herod was angry with them. He was to
take Mary and Jesus to safety in Egypt. So, Joseph,
Mary, and Jesus traveled to Egypt and lived there
until Herod was dead. Then they went back to the
town of Nazareth in the Holy Land.

Papa shut the Bible. Honey was fast asleep and


Brothers and Sisters eyes were closing.
Good night, said Papa, tucking Brother and
Sister in. God bless you!
Night, Papa, murmured Brother and Sister,
sleepily. Bless you!
Papa picked up Honey to carry her to bed.
Bible stories were a good choice, he said to
himself.
And he tip-toed softly out of the room.
